About the Position
As a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ant with RehabVisions, you will work under the direction of a licensed Occupational Therapist to help students develop functional skills that support their academic participation, independence and overall success.
Responsibilities
- Implement occupational therapy treatment plans established by the supervising Occupational Therapist
- Provide individualized and small-group therapy services based on student needs
- Support students in developing fine-motor, sensory-processing, self-care and functional participation skills
- Monitor student progress and communicate observations to the supervising Occupational Therapist
- Complete accurate and timely treatment documentation
- Collaborate with teachers, school staff, families and members of the student’s educational team
- Participate in meetings and contribute information related to student progress when appropriate
- Maintain compliance with professional, organizational and school-district requirements
- Assist with program development and the general operation of therapy services
- Provide limited virtual-school or home health coverage when assigned to the applicable position
